Minutes — Management Meeting, Brindlehook Software. Present: full management team; apologies from R. Quill. Main item: shifting Fernwhistle customers from monthly to annual billing. Consensus was that it's overdue — churn data backs it up, and finance likes the cash-flow bump. Discount tier for early movers approved in principle; marketing to draft comms by month-end. Tansy flagged possible pushback from smaller accounts, noted for follow-up. For the board's eyes, the rationale ties into the note below.

board note of fahif-yahog: Gross margin on Wenath came in at 10 percent against a plan of 5 percent. Only 3 of the 100 pilot accounts renewed Wenath, so a churn review is set for July 15.

**Ticket PTW-208: Webhook env misconfiguration affecting plugin deliveries**

Plugin authors reported that Parcelarc webhook deliveries were signed against the sandbox key while targeting production endpoints, causing every signature verification to fail. Root cause: the deploy template copied the sandbox block into the production env file. The corrected file keeps endpoint variables unchanged; only the signing entry differs between environments. The production signing entry now appears on the following line.

env line for fafof-fahag: LEDGER_TOKEN5=f8790

Subject: DR Drill — Template Rendering Path

Welcome aboard, everyone. Next Thursday we will run a disaster-recovery drill simulating loss of the Plumeria render cluster, which handles template rendering for the Oakhollow notification service. You will fail traffic to the cold standby and verify render latency stays under budget. Please read the runbook beforehand and shadow your assigned buddy. To unseal the standby's credential vault, use the recovery passphrase below.

unlock words, bahop-yagef: wenmir-fraael-lamys